Transaction 76e36d64d543f20e37ff6818f57549120786c8e80338fe776d04643635f48612
1 Input
1 Output
-
76e36d64d543f20e37ff6818f57549120786c8e80338fe776d04643635f48612:0
- value
- 62261642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86498fb1616013785fb0f76fba5404f70eba92dd OP_EQUAL
- address
- ML9CuGH5daQ2UUqc5oRCf1eewpuzJgcFds